Lost power at 10pm last night, restored this morning. With no power I had sump issues with it filling up every 30 minutes or so. Had to jury rig a battery powered sump pump so I could a little sleep. Used a bilge pump from one of my R/C warships, an 20AH tank battery, a float switch from a discarded sump pump, some wire and wire nuts. Used a 50' air hose to route the water to my slop sink. Worked great, the little wiper pump based R/C bilge pump pumped the sump down in 5 minutes each time. Will be upgrading this expedient to a more permanent design shortly.
